SBI PO 2022 Eligibility Criteria

Candidates who wish to apply online for SBI PO Exam 2019 need to fulfill the under-mentioned eligibility criteria. We have mentioned below the official SBI PO Eligibility Criteria for you, take a look:

(a) Age-based Eligibility (As on 01.04.2022)
Candidates between the age of 21 years to 30 years (both inclusive) can apply for SBI PO 2022 recruitment.

(b) Educational Qualification (As on 31.12.2022)
(The below-mentioned eligibility details should be fulfilled as on 31/12/2022)
Candidates should possess a graduation degree or any equivalent qualification from a recognized university.

Those who are in the Final Year/Semester of their Graduation may also apply provisionally, subject to the condition that, if called for an interview, they will have to produce a proof of having passed the graduation examination on or before 31.12.2022.

SBI PO Mains Exam Pattern - Descriptive

The Descriptive Test of 30 minutes duration with two questions for 50 marks will be a Test of English Language (Letter Writing & Essay)

Phase 3: Group Exercise and Interview

Candidates numbering up to 3 times (approx.) the category wise vacancies will be shortlisted for the Group Exercise & Interview from the top of the category wise merit list subject to a candidate scoring the minimum aggregate qualifying score.

Penalty for Wrong Answers (Applicable to both - Preliminary and Main Exam): There will be a penalty for wrong answers marked in the Objective Tests. For each question for which a wrong answer has been given by the candidate, 1/4th of marks assigned to that question will be deducted as penalty to arrive at corrected score.
